I am looking for help for my sick goldfish. She is a 9 year old comet goldfish named Jack about 9 inches long. She is in a 30 gallon tank by herself with only gravel in it right now. One morning she was at bottom of tank and flipped upside down. Then she moved around and swam to top, she went back upright and to the bottom of tank. This is how it started. Then she was slightly on her side and seemed to be stressed. I immediately called around and researched. She has red streaks like in the tail fin, later after about 5 days the body from approx the anus to tail fin turned red/pinkish. She mostly hangs at the bottom in the corner by the airstone. She swims a bit here and there and seems to kinda sink back down as she is swimming back to the bottom. The redness got worse and scales seem to be out similiar to dropsy, and only in this part of her body. I spoke with a few fish people at pet stores and was told at first it was septicimia, bacterial infection, then later dropsy(due to the infection??). She has not and will not eat for about 14 days now. I have been putting in Kordons all natural disease treatment. I did 7 days, then 20% water change. I am on the second treatment for 5 days now. I also was told to put in aquarium salt so I did that. I also was told to keep temperature between 78-80 degrees. Then I was told it is too high and to lower temp under 70 degrees. I had the water tested and it was pretty good, but thinking I should test again. There is not really any improvement and she looks the same.
